绿云梨的动态特性试验研究

摘    要:利用应力-应变动态试验测定了绿云梨的动态特性,发现在不同预知载荷、激振功率、成熟程度等条件下梨果实动态试验的弹性模量和相位角明显不同。在相同频率下,随预加载荷的增加弹性模量增加;在相同预载荷、激振功率和频率下,未成熟绿云梨的动态试验相位角较小,成熟绿云型的相位角较大,未成熟绿云梨的动态试验弹性模量较大,成熟绿云梨的弹性模量较小。

Research on Dynamic Properties of Pear

Abstract:The article describes a dynamic method for measuring the elastic modulus and phase angle of pear over a range of frequencies. Experiments were conducted to measure the elastic modulus and phase angle, and their relationship with initial stress, vibration input and ripeness of pear. As expected, initial stress had a significant effect on the magnitude of the elastic modulus, but not on the phase angle. Vibration amplitude (power) had little effect on the elastic modulus and phase angle. Especially, the elastic modulus and phase angle were significantly influenced by ripeness of pear. The more ripeness was, the less elastic modulus and the bigger phase angle was. Therefore, it was proposed that the values of the elastic modulus and phase angle can be used to evaluate ripeness of pear.
